Benefits of Hiring a Registered Agent

A primary benefits of hiring a registered agent is maintaining compliance with state regulations. A registered agent is responsible for accepting legal documents and notices on behalf of a business, making sure that important communications reach the right person promptly. By having a reliable registered agent, companies can avoid overlooking critical deadlines that could lead to penalties or legal issues. This fosters a seamless business operation while helping to manage legal obligations efficiently.

Another advantage is privacy protection. Operating a business often requires disclosing personal information, such as the owner's name and address, in public records. By appointing a registered agent, business owners can keep their personal details confidential, as the agent’s contact details becomes the contact point for legal notifications and communications. This added layer of privacy helps business owners protect their personal security while ensuring that their business remains compliant.

Cost and Costs Associated with Registered Agents

As considering registered agent solutions, one of the key concerns for entrepreneurs is the price involved. Registered agent fees can fluctuate significantly based on the company and the level of service offered. Most companies charge an yearly fee ranging from $50 to three hundred USD. It is crucial to evaluate different registered agent providers to find the best registered agent services that match your budget and provide the necessary services for your business.

In addition to the basic registration fees, there may be extra costs associated with particular services. For example, some registered agent companies provide mail forwarding services, compliance reminders, or supplementary support for an additional charge. It is prudent to ask about these potential services when hiring a registered agent to ensure there are no concealed costs that could impact your financial situation in the long term.

Judicial Obligations of Official Facilitators

Designated agents play a critical function in the regulatory framework of corporate compliance. One of their chief obligations is to act as the assigned receiver for legal documents, verifying that process serving is handled swiftly and correctly. This entails receiving important notices, such as lawsuits, tax documents, and regulatory notifications from oversight bodies. The swift forwarding of these documents to the entrepreneur is essential for meeting legal requirements and avoiding potential sanctions.

In alongside handling official documents, official agents are charged with maintaining accurate records related to the firm's compliance standing. This includes managing yearly compliance filings, tracking timelines for various jurisdictional requirements, and dispatching reminders to entrepreneurs when filings are due. By maintaining meticulous records, authorized agents help firms avoid breakdowns in compliance that could lead to legal issues or problems.
